Excerpt from The Asuri-Kalpa: A Witchcraft Practice of the Atharva-Veda, With an Introduction, Translation and Commentary
A, large sheets of light yellow paper, bound in book form, written lengthwise in a large clear hand and with considerable care. Itis a modern copy.
B, narrow sheets of light blue paper, bound in book form, written lengthwise, text fuller in places than the preceding, but in a poor hand and with numerous errors. It must be a very recent copy. Both of these mss are numbered 23.
